>>       Is there a way to update an export without disrupting clients that
> are
>> actively using an export? The current method I know of is to use
>> 'ganesha_mgr remove_export' followed by a 'ganesha_mgr add_export'. I
>> do not see an 'update_export' option or similar in the above command. Are
>> there any plans to provide an update option in the future?
> Ganesha V2.4.0 has a new "dynamic export update" feature. A specific export
> can be updated with dBus, and all exports in the config are refreshed on
> SIGHUP. With this, you can dynamically update everything except export_id,
> path, and pseudo, those basically imply removing the export and adding it
> again, so just use the dBus remove and add commands. SIGHUP will also add
> any new exports that have been added to the config file (it will not remove
> any exports - it doesn't make any check to see if any export was no longer
> present in the config file). The dBus update export will also add the export
> if the specified export does not already exist.
>
> The update process uses atomic operations to update all the fields in the
> export except the CLIENT blocks. The CLIENT blocks are atomically replaced
> (update builds a new list of clients/permissions and then takes a lock on
> the list and swaps the old list with the new list).
>
> The end result is that clients will see no disruption (well, if the new
> client list excludes a client that previously had access, of course it will
> lose access as soon as the client list is swapped out).
